





Above you will get a first look at what is known as the Nike Kyrie 4 Year Of The Monkey. Turns out that this new colorway of the model actually dropped in Hong Kong this week (according to flightclub.cn). Said to be celebrate Kyrie’s upcoming 26th birthday, the reason the shoe is dubbed the Year Of The Monkey (although 2018 is the Year Of The Dog) is because Kyrie was born in 1992, which was a Tear Of The Monkey (along with 2004 and 2016).
Standout features on the Nike Kyrie 4 Year Of The Monkey include the mulitcolored outsole, mismatched tongue monkey logos (Blue and Red), a Black upper with a textured suede side panel and hairy suede on the Swoosh.
